Cppcheck Portable

2.5

Perform a thorough analysis of your C and C++ code in order to identify memory leaks, buffer overruns and various other issues, with this portable utility

Cppcheck Portable is a software tool which was developed in order to provide static analysis of C or C++ code. It is designed to detect the types of bugs that compilers cannot normally find, and it features a minimalistic and intuitive UI.

Requires no installation and can be deployed easily


This tool is the portable counterpart of Cppcheck, which means the Windows registry and Start menu/screen are not going to suffer any changes. Additionally, after its removal, there will be no leftover files.
Another aspect worth mentioning is that by moving the program files to a portable storage unit (e.g. USB flash drive), it is possible to use Cppcheck Portable on any computer you can connect to. No need to worry about the installation process, as it is not a prerequisite.

Perform a complete analysis of your C or C++ code


The interface is intuitive and encloses a menu bar, several shortcut buttons and two panels to display uploaded documents and messages. Nevertheless, not all user categories will be able to handle it, due to the lingo present all throughout the utility.
It enables you to check the code for each class, invalid usage of STL, exception safety, and if it is out of bounds, as well as warn if obsolete functions are present.
It is possible to view the total number of errors, warnings, information messages, performance issues and other statistics, in a new window and copy them to the Clipboard for further analysis.

Lightweight tool that puts an extensive user manual at your disposal


Comprehensive and well-organized Help contents are provided, while our tests have revealed that the computer’s performance will not be hindered.
To sum up, Cppcheck Porable is an efficient piece of software, with a good response time, user-friendly environment and enough options to help you check all aspect of your C or C++ code.
25.4 MB
4.8
Info
Update Date
Version
2.5
License
GPLv3
Created By
John T. Haller
Related software Portable